Output 83aba934d5a1d3156f2c9006e974f4efbc3430201d8fd7cfbcd3907f1676532f:1

value
553302
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dea58d3c65fdec0f95eb983a225670862ce7e0c4aa4f212042cb4972b7cd394b
address
bc1pm6jc60r9lhkql90tnqazy4nssckw0cxy4f8jzgzzedyh9d7d899sdmsslp
transaction
83aba934d5a1d3156f2c9006e974f4efbc3430201d8fd7cfbcd3907f1676532f
spent
true